US forces illegally deployed to Yemeni province of Lahj

The United States of America has unofficially deployed a number of its soldiers in the Yafea district of Lahj province, southern Yemen.

This step may indicate plans to protect remaining Al-Qaeda elements that fled from Bayda province towards Yafea area, as well as to Abyan and Ma’rib provinces.

Activists circulated pictures of recruits from Yafea area who have American citizenship and previously worked in the US army during their arrival to the border area with Bayda, affirming that they returned during the past few days under the name of “defending Yafea.”

The American recruits are currently participating in the occupation of the Al-Arr mountain in Yefea.

The US Department of Defence confirmed several weeks ago that it was seeking to form new factions in Yemen loyal to Washington, under the pretext of “fighting terrorism”, noting that its support would be limited to the border guards and the coast guard.
